Description

Frame construction in formula case room soon assembles
Technical Field
The utility model relates to a box room technical field specifically is a frame construction in formula case room soon is pieced together.
Background
Box room is a portable, repeatedly usable's building product, and its simple structure can carry out quick assembly, and simple to operate is swift, is used to the real estate development company and sells building exhibition room and product and sell exhibition room and temporary reception center and shop etc. and the inside of box room need use frame construction to support.
However, the frame structure of the quick-splicing box room is in the actual use process, the length of the supporting component inside the frame is mostly fixed, the built frame structure cannot be adjusted in height in use, and the use is inconvenient, so that the frame structure of the novel quick-splicing box room is needed to solve the defects.

Example 1: referring to fig. 1-5, a frame structure of a quick-splicing box room includes a first side frame 2 and a second side frame 3, the top end of the first side frame 2 is provided with the second side frame 3, the right side of the second side frame 3 is provided with a third side frame 8, the right side of the first side frame 2 is provided with a fourth side frame 9, two ends of the top of the right side of the second side frame 3 are respectively and transversely provided with a first cross frame 6, two ends of the bottom of the right side of the first side frame 2 are respectively and transversely provided with a second cross frame 15, two sides of the bottom of the first cross frame 6 are respectively and vertically provided with a support pillar 7, two ends of the bottoms of the second side frame 3 and the third side frame 8 are respectively and vertically fixed with a connecting rod 18, the inside of one side of the connecting rod 18 is provided with an inner groove 19, the inside of two ends of the first side frame 2 and the fourth side frame 9 are respectively and vertically provided with an inner groove 20, and two ends of the top of the left sides of the first side frame 2 and the fourth side frame 9 are respectively and provided with a screw hole 17;
the bottom end of the connecting rod 18 penetrates through the inner part of the inner groove 20, four groups of screw holes 19 are arranged in the inner part of one side of the connecting rod 18 at equal intervals, external threads are arranged outside the locking rod 17, and internal threads matched with the external threads are arranged in the screw holes 19;
specifically, as shown in fig. 1 and 3, after the frame structure is constructed, the locking rods 17 may be screwed out from the current screw holes 19 in the connecting rods 18 at two ends of the top of one side of the first side frame 2 and the fourth side frame 9, respectively, so that the second side frame 3 and the third side frame 8 may be lifted upward at the top ends of the first side frame 2 and the fourth side frame 9 by using the connecting rods 18, and after the locking rods 17 are screwed and locked in the screw holes 19 corresponding to different positions, the use height of the whole frame may be lifted upward.
Example 2: two sides of the first cross frame 6 and the second cross frame 15 are respectively fixed with a connecting pin 1, a threaded hole 16 is arranged in the connecting pin 1, two ends of one side top of the second side frame 3 and the third side frame 8 and two ends of one side bottom of the first side frame 2 and the fourth side frame 9 are respectively provided with a connecting socket 5, two ends of the second side frame 3 and the third side frame 8 and two ends of the first side frame 2 and the fourth side frame 9 are respectively provided with a connecting bolt 10 in a penetrating way, two sides of the bottom end of the first cross frame 6 and two sides of the top end of the second cross frame 15 are respectively provided with a positioning block 4, one side and the top end of the positioning block 4 are respectively fixed with an inserting block 22, two sides of the bottom end of the first cross frame 6 and two sides of the top end of the threaded hole 16 and two ends of one side of the first side frame 2, the second side frame 3, the third side frame 8 and the fourth side frame 9 are respectively provided with an inserting groove 21, and the first side frame 2, the fourth side frame 3 and the third side frame 8 are respectively arranged symmetrically about the vertical central line of the first cross frame 6;
specifically, as shown in fig. 1 and 4, after two sets of first cross frames 6 and two sets of second cross frames 15 are respectively inserted into the connecting sockets 5 arranged inside one side of the first side frame 2, the second side frame 3, the third side frame 8 and the fourth side frame 9 corresponding to the two sets of fixed connecting pins 1, the two ends of the first side frame 2, the second side frame 3, the third side frame 8 and the fourth side frame 9 are respectively screwed into the threaded holes 16 inside the connecting pins 1 by using the connecting bolts 10, the construction of the frame structure main body can be rapidly completed, and then, after the positioning blocks 4 are respectively inserted into the slots 21 by using the insertion blocks 22, the first cross frames 6, the second side frames 3 and the third side frames 8, the first side frame 2, the second cross frames 15 and the fourth side frames 9 can be positioned in an auxiliary manner, so as to improve the stability of the frame structure.
Example 3: a second fixture block 23 is movably connected to the top end of the support column 7, first square grooves 13 are respectively formed in the inner portions of two sides of the bottom end of the first transverse frame 6 and the inner portions of two sides of the top end of the second transverse frame 15, a threaded opening 11 is formed in the inner portion of the bottom end of the support column 7, an extension rod 12 is arranged in the threaded opening 11, external threads are arranged on the outer portion of the extension rod 12, and a first fixture block 14 is fixed to the bottom end of the threaded opening 11;
specifically, as shown in fig. 1 and 5, after the first fixture block 14 fixed at the bottom end of the stretching rod 12 is clamped into the first square groove 13 inside the top end of the second cross frame 15, the support column 7 is rotated at the top end of the stretching rod 12, the support column 7 can ascend in the rotating process by using the threaded connection between the threaded opening 11 and the stretching rod 12, the top end of the support column 7 can be fixed at the bottom end of the first cross frame 6 by using the second fixture block 23 at the top end, the support column 7 can be continuously rotated to abut against the first cross frame 6 and the support column 7, and the support and reinforcement can be assisted to the structure inside the frame by using the four groups of support columns 7 and stretching rods 12 arranged on two sides of the two ends inside.
